Wine Review: This clear and midnight purple colored Cabernet Sauvignon based blend from Figgins is incredibly impressive given its age. It opens with a menthol and black cherry bouquet with hints of teaberry gum and pine pitch. On the palate, this wine is full bodied with integrated plus acidity. The mouthfeel is balanced, silky, and polished. The flavor profile is cassis and black cherry blend with notes of stone dust and oak. We also detected hints of chocolate, oolong tea, and basil. The finish is dry, and its flavors, acidity, and dusty tannins build-up and linger and last for a while. We could certainly drink this wine on its own. With food, we would pair this Cab blend with New York strip steak or with Stuart’s steak treats. Enjoy - KWGTP
Winemaker Notes: Rich in color, the wine entices you with an intoxicating nose of baking spices, cherry compote, wild roses, cassis, and caramel apple. Layer upon layer of perfectly ripe red and black fruits and silky tannin engage the palate. I have not been this excited about a Figgins release since my inaugural vintage in 2008!
